 Altoids -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Altoids are a popular brand of breath mints that have existed since the turn of the 19th century.
Altoids are produced in Britain by Callard and Bowser-Suchard at Bridgend, Wales, although Wrigley, the brand's owner, announced in mid 2005 they planned to move Altoids production to an existing plant in Chattanooga, Tennessee in order to manufacture its products closer to where they are sold.

 The Altoids Curiously Strong Collection
In 2000, Altoids donated the entire Curiously Strong Collection, including all works subsequently added to the Collection, to the New Museum of Contemporary Art, the Museum's first-ever acceptance of a corporate collection.
Altoids® created the Curiously Strong Collection® in 1998 to honor and support today's most talented, emerging visual artists.
Altoids donated the entire Collection to the New Museum, marking their first-ever acceptance of a corporate Collection.

 Wrigley expands plant in Altoids production shift - Aug. 23, 2005
NEW YORK (CNN/Money) - Altoids, the "curiously strong mints," are crossing the Atlantic to begin a new phase of their production history, and U.S. workers have reason to cheer.
Wrigley's, which acquired the Altoids brand when it purchased Kraft's candy business in 2004, said investment in the expansion and equipment comes to about $14 million.
Altoids, which were created by a London company, have been made in Great Britain since the reign of King George III, according to the candy's Web site.
